Recognise the Problem: Chaotic Sleep Patterns
Late nights followed by early mornings. Emergency lie-ins that throw off your entire week. Sound familiar? Many students live in a constant state of sleep chaos, spinning the clock hands wildly and wondering why they feel drained. The truth is, your body isn't designed to thrive on unpredictability. It craves rhythm. When that rhythm is broken, everything else—your concentration, your memory, your ability to handle stress—suffers.
Set a Consistent Sleep Schedule
Think of your body like a laptop battery. Constant drain-and-surge cycles shorten its performance over time. The solution? Set regular sleep hours and stick to them. Go to bed at the same time every night and wake up at the same time every morning, even on weekends. Yes, it sounds boring. But predictability is your secret weapon. Your energy will stop spiking and crashing. Instead, it will become steady and reliable—the kind of energy that helps you power through lectures, essays, and exam revision without hitting a wall.
- Choose a bedtime that allows for your target hours of sleep (most adults need 7-9 hours).
- Set a recurring alarm on your phone to remind you when it's time to wind down.
- Treat your bedtime with the same importance as a deadline or a class.
Avoid Sleep Disruptors Like Naps and All-Nighters
Here's the hard truth: naps and all-nighters are not your friends. That 'emergency' afternoon nap? It often turns into a time warp that leaves you groggy and throws off your night's sleep. That heroic all-nighter before an exam? It wrecks not just the next day, but the two days after that. Your sleep cycle is delicate. Disrupting it has consequences.
Instead of reaching for quick fixes, protect your rhythm. If you're tired during the day, resist the urge to collapse on the sofa. Go for a walk, grab a healthy snack, or do a quick burst of movement. Pair your consistent sleep with decent meals and some regular exercise, and you'll feel the difference fast. Small daily choices add up to steadier energy and better focus.
